The Illawarra Hawks won 108-90 against the Cairns Taipans in the NBL 2023-2024 preseason held at the Gold Coast Convention Center in Queensland, Australia on the 22nd. Illawarra won two games in a row and recorded a preseason record of 3 wins and 1 loss.
Hyunjoong Lee contributed to the team’s victory by recording 15 points, 3 rebounds, 2 steals, and 1 block in 20 minutes and 18 seconds. The 15 points were the 3rd highest on the team. Although he was a substitute in the 4th game, Hyun-joong Lee scored 3-pointers in each quarter and scored in double figures for the first time in the preseason. His field goal percentage was 62% (5/8), including making 4 of 5 3-pointers.
